The second thing that needs to be considered when deciding on purchasing a condominium is affordability . A mortgage calculator can help provide insight into what kind of monthly payments are affordable based on current interest rates as well as how quickly you plan on paying off the loan. It’s important not only to take into account what type of home fits within your budget, but also which location works best with where you want to live and how much money you can afford to put away every month.

The third factor that should be considered before buying a condo is the state of your credit score . Good credit not only helps get better rates on mortgages, but it will also help improve approval times when trying to secure home and auto insurance quotes.
